I took Xenical for a while, and couldn't tell it did a thing at all for me. I also tried Meridia, which made me exhausted and sleepy. I would have to come home and take a nap after work each day. I felt like I was back in the early stages of pregnancy. I also took Phentermine, and I only felt like it worked for the first week or two.
